What is Programmatic Video Advertising?

Programmatic video advertising refers to the automated process of purchasing and delivering video ads using software technologies rather than traditional manual methods. This approach uses data-driven algorithms to target specific audiences in real-time, optimizing ad spend and enhancing campaign effectiveness. It enables advertisers to deliver personalized content across various devices and platforms seamlessly.

Increasing Use of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ning

One major trend shaping the future of programmatic video advertising is the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ML). These technologies allow for smarter audience segmentation, better prediction of ad performance, and dynamic adjustment of campaigns to improve engagement rates. AI-powered tools can analyze vast amounts of data quickly, enabling more precise targeting and creative optimization tailored to viewer preferences.

Growth in Connected TV (CTV) Advertising

Connected TV has become a significant channel for programmatic video ads as more consumers shift from traditional TV viewing to streaming services on smart TVs. Programmatic buying enables advertisers to reach viewers with targeted messages on CTV platforms efficiently. This growth presents opportunities for brands to combine the visual impact of television with the targeting capabilities typical in digital media.

Emphasis on Data Privacy and Transparency

With increasing concerns around data privacy regulations such as GDPR and CCPA, programmatic video advertising is evolving toward greater transparency in data usage. Advertisers are adopting privacy-first approaches by leveraging first-party data while ensuring compliance with legal standards. Transparency about how consumer information is collected and used helps build trust between brands, publishers, and audiences.

Early Life and Introduction to Basketball

Earvin ‘Magic’ Johnson Jr. was born in Lansing, Michigan, where he developed an early passion for basketball. His natural talent blossomed during his high school years, setting the stage for an illustrious athletic career. Understanding these formative years provides insight into how Magic’s dedication and work ethic shaped his future success.

Collegiate Success at Michigan State University

Magic Johnson attended Michigan State University, where he showcased exceptional playmaking abilities. Leading the Spartans to an NCAA Championship victory in 1979 was a pivotal moment, highlighting his leadership and skill under pressure. This period solidified his reputation as a rising star in basketball.

NBA Career and Championships with the Los Angeles Lakers

Drafted first overall by the Los Angeles Lakers in 1979, Magic quickly made an impact in the NBA. His versatility as a point guard led to five NBA championships throughout the 1980s. Known for his flashy passes and charismatic presence, Magic became synonymous with “Showtime” basketball — fast-paced and entertaining.

Off-Court Achievements and Business Ventures

Beyond basketball, Magic Johnson successfully transitioned into business and philanthropy. He has been involved in various enterprises including movie theaters, real estate investments, and ownership stakes in sports teams. His biography reveals how he leveraged his fame to make significant contributions to communities and inspire entrepreneurial success.

Legacy and Influence on Future Generations

Magic Johnson’s biography illustrates not just athletic prowess but also resilience — especially after publicly announcing his HIV diagnosis while continuing to advocate awareness worldwide. His legacy continues through mentoring young athletes and promoting inclusivity within sports culture.

Why Broadband Prices Vary by Region

Broadband costs are influenced by several factors including infrastructure availability, competition among providers, and regional demand. Urban areas often have multiple providers competing, which can drive prices down. Conversely, in rural or less densely populated regions, fewer providers may lead to higher costs due to increased infrastructure investment requirements.

How Postcodes Affect Your Broadband Options

Your postcode determines the types of broadband technology available in your area such as fiber optic, DSL, or satellite. Some postcodes may have access to high-speed fiber networks offering competitive pricing, while others might only have slower connections with limited provider options. Checking broadband offers specific to your postcode ensures you get accurate information reflecting what’s realistically available.
